What would happen to an ecosystem if a drought killed half of the plants that lived there?

Answer:

Most other living things would die or find it so hard to adapt

Explanation:

The Eco-system is made of organism that depend on each other for survival.

When a drought happens to an Eco-system and half of the plants die, animals that depends on such plants for food would  now have limited food available to them. they would find it hard to adapt and maybe leave the environment or probably die
